    The Danes would negotiate with Trump for the placement of military bases in Greenland.

    12 May 2026
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Email VKontakte Telegram WhatsApp Copy Link
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Email Copy Link

    The USA and Denmark are negotiating the placement of military bases in Greenland, foreign press reports, citing sources familiar with the negotiations. It’s about three objectives, which could be inaugurated in the south of the island and declared “sovereign territory of the USA”.

    President Trump declared in January that the USA should “own” Greenland to prevent Russia or China from taking it over, specifying that this could happen “the easy way” or “the hard way”.

    On the territory of the bases, Russian and Chinese maritime activities are expected to be monitored in the strategic area located in the maritime corridor situated between Greenland, Iceland, and the United Kingdom.

    The White House confirms that the administration is engaged in high-level discussions with Greenland and Denmark, but refuses to comment on the details of the negotiations, reports hotnews.ro. In turn, the Danish Ministry of Foreign Affairs confirms that discussions are taking place with the USA, expressing its willingness for the establishment of additional bases.

    The final number of bases could change, and one of the new facilities is expected to be located in Narsarsuaq, on the site of a former American military base that housed a small airport.

    Analysts assert that any other new bases would likely be located on lands that already have infrastructure, such as airfields or ports, which could be modernized at a lower cost than building new facilities.
